Imprisoned in a secret Murkoff facility, players will be thrust into a series of physical and mental ordeals, tormented by iconic characters, and challenged alone or in teams to survive with their sanity intact. Set in the height of the Cold War era, players take on the role of test subjects abducted by the shadowy Murkoff Corporation. A whole new take on the Outlast survival horror experience, The Outlast Trials is a terrifying game set in the same universe as the previous titles for one to four players, set for release during 2022.
